Output 3c49585b24f0b3ccccda39bcb32641cc8e6a89d8ca42db13a43366d0e9e2deee:76

value
569161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c375b0f7b0cb1116272ddc4d6a5f2fbb444f09a OP_EQUAL
address
37BQnEc6hxbymRTgEZKbPBmah9MeX2c4nr
transaction
3c49585b24f0b3ccccda39bcb32641cc8e6a89d8ca42db13a43366d0e9e2deee
spent
true